Warsaw Uprising Monument
Reflect on the defining moment in Warsaw’s modern history at this moving monument, a tribute to the city’s Home Army, who fought tirelessly for their city.

Old Town Market Place
The heart of Warsaw’s Old Town, this lively square is lined with picturesque buildings from the 1600s and 1700s.
